Abstract

La présente invention concerne un procédé et un appareil permettant de mesurer la position de l'oeil jusqu'à 6° de liberté, de mesurer le diamètre de la pupille et de l'identité de l'oeil dans différents instruments de diagnostic et de traitement, et de relier ensemble ces différentes positions mesurées à différents moments et/ou dans différents instruments. Ce procédé utilisé pour relier ensemble les mesures de position constitue une transformation de coordonnées entre les différents systèmes de coordonnées système et le système de coordonnées de l'oeil tel que mesuré par le traitement d'image ou par d'autres techniques de mesure pour obtenir soit des mesures simples, soit des mesures combinées de degrés de liberté. En plus de la position de l'oeil, on peut mesurer et reconnaître l'identité de l'oeil soumis à un diagnostic ou à un traitement dans les différents instruments et systèmes. On peut également mesurer la position de l'oeil et le diamètre de la pupille par différentes techniques de mesure, notamment l'analyse d'images vidéo normalisée ou non à partir d'une ou de plusieurs caméras par système, la tomographie par cohérence optique, l'interférométrie laser ou autres.
